Latvian and Sinhalese ISO Language Codes

ISO language codes are designed to represent most of the languages in the world. Latvian and Sinhalese ISO language codes consists of ISO 639 1, ISO 639 2, ISO 639 3 codes. ISO 639 1 is the two letter code, while ISO 639 2 and ISO 639 3 are three letter codes.

    Latvian ISO Codes:
  • ISO 639 1 code: lv
  • ISO 639 2/T code: lav
  • ISO 639 2/B code: lav
  • ISO 639 3 code: lav
    Sinhalese ISO Codes:
  • ISO 639 1 code: si
  • ISO 639 2/T code: sin
  • ISO 639 2/B code: sin
  • ISO 639 3 code: sin

Latvian vs Sinhalese Glottocodes

You will find Latvian vs Sinhalese glottocodes under the Latvian and Sinhalese language codes. Latvian glottocode is latv1249 and Sinhalese glottocode is sinh1246. Along with Latvian and Sinhalese language codes, you can also check how many people speak these languages on Latvian vs Sinhalese.
